Day trips from Casciago: lakes, mountains, and border lands
Casciago makes a superb launch pad for day trips that feed every traveler’s curiosity. Here are a few ideas that pair well with a social, active holiday:
- Lake Como and the Pre-Alps: A short drive or train ride brings you to Lombardy’s famous shoreline towns where villa gardens open to dramatic alpine silhouettes. Whether you wander Como town, take a boat ride across the lake, or hike a lakeside path, it’s a day that feels like a movie montage—perfect for sharing on social channels with a touch of elegance.
- Lugano, Switzerland: Just over the border, Lugano offers a blend of Swiss precision and Italian flair, with lakefront promenades, parklands, and chic cafés. It’s easy to combine with Casciago for a fun, cosmopolitan edge to your itinerary.
- Monte Rosa and surrounding peaks: For groups that love a proper outdoor challenge, mountaineous routes and ridges offer rewarding views and a sense of accomplishment to cap off active days.
- Campo dei Fiori Regional Park: This less-visited nature reserve near Varese is ideal for long hikes, picnic lunches, and an opportunity to spot local wildlife in a less crowded setting.
Seasonal tips and packing for Casciago
Casciago’s seasons invite different kinds of adventures. Here’s a quick guide to help you tailor your packing list for a group holiday that stays stylish and comfortable:
- Spring (April–June): Mild days with fresh blooms. Pack light layers, a light jacket, comfy walking shoes, and a portable picnic blanket for lakeside afternoons.
- Summer (July–August): Warm days, longer evenings. Bring sun protection, swimsuits for lakeside dips, breathable clothing, and a compact camera to capture the sunsets that linger in Lombardy’s skies.
- Autumn (September–October): Crisp air and harvest flavors. A versatile sweater, a light rain jacket, and a sturdy pair of boots are ideal for vineyard visits and hillside strolls.
- Winter (November–March): Cold but cozy. Layered outfits, a warm coat, and a plan for indoor gatherings—think cooking nights, board games, and movie marathons in your Suite Suite Accommodation.
